Abstract

In an investigation of the nature of activation in elimination reactions, rates of elimination of phenoxide under basic conditions from a series of 17 phenyl ethers of the type X–CH2· CH2· OPh have been measured. Second-order rate constants span a range of 1011 according to the nature of X.
